S*-ORLICZ LATTICE

open access: yesJournal of Kufa for Mathematics and Computer, 2010
In this paper, we review here some of the ideas we have encountered in Orlicz function and define S*- Orlicz lattice. We have proved that S*-Orlicz space (X, ||.||F) is a normed S*-Vector Lattice, complete and therefore, it's a Banach S*-Vector Lattice.
